Did you know that there is a big difference between antiperspirant and deodorant? Antiperspirants work by preventing perspiration from occurring. Deodorants allow perspiration but block odor.

Deodorants accomplish this by killing the bacteria that cause odor. From a purely natural standpoint, it makes more sense for us to use deodorants, as it is a more natural process.
